changeset 181:500c09718fd7

Added fresh paste marker.
author Edho Arief <edho@myconan.net>
date Fri, 01 Feb 2013 22:58:53 +0700
parents dd5a154c17c7
children 0bda7690529c
files app/controllers/pastes_controller.rb app/helpers/pastes_helper.rb
diffstat 2 files changed, 6 insertions(+), 1 deletions(-) [+]
line wrap: on
line diff
--- a/app/controllers/pastes_controller.rb	Fri Feb 01 22:57:49 2013 +0700
+++ b/app/controllers/pastes_controller.rb	Fri Feb 01 22:58:53 2013 +0700
@@ -52,6 +52,7 @@
     begin
       respond_to do |format|
         if @paste.save
+          @fresh = true
           format.html { redirect_to @paste, :notice => 'Paste was successfully created.' }
           format.json { render :json => @paste, :status => :created, :location => @paste }
         else
--- a/app/helpers/pastes_helper.rb	Fri Feb 01 22:57:49 2013 +0700
+++ b/app/helpers/pastes_helper.rb	Fri Feb 01 22:58:53 2013 +0700
@@ -2,7 +2,11 @@
   def print_txt_create_result
     unless @paste.errors.any?
       url =  paste_path @paste, :only_path => false
-      "#{url} (key: #{@paste.key})"
+      if @fresh
+        "#{url} (key: #{@paste.key})"
+      else
+        url
+      end
     else
       'Failed'
     end